Diploma in Electrical Engineering (Lateral Entry) at SETGOI Overview
Sanaka Educational Trust's Group of Institutions offers a 2 years Diploma in Electrical Engineering (Lateral Entry) programme. The institute offers the course at UG level in Engineering stream. Candidates can check out the below table for more information on Sanaka Educational Trust's Group of Institutions Diploma in Electrical Engineering (Lateral Entry):
Duration | 2 years |
Course Level | UG Diploma |
Mode of Course | Full Time |
Official Website | Go to Website |
Seat breakup | 60 |
Type of University | Private |
Diploma in Electrical Engineering (Lateral Entry) at SETGOI Highlights
- Course is affiliated to West Bengal State Council of Technical Education (WBSCTE)

Diploma in Electrical Engineering (Lateral Entry) at SETGOI Admission Process
- Register and ApplyInterested candidates can apply online/ offline with the required information.
- CounsellingAdmission is through counselling conducted by West Bengal State Council of Technical Education (WBSCTE) based on the rank obtained in Vocational Lateral Entry Examination (VOCLET).

The job stability after a major degree course in Electrical Engineering is quite promising. Electrical engineers can work with private companies as well as government undertakings as Electronics and Electrical Engineers, Project Engineers, Control Systems Engineers, Equipment Testing Engineers, Power Systems Engineer, etc. The job scope is vast, with top recruiters in India offering handsome salary packages to fresh talented electrical engineers. Rising human population and their demand for electricity, focus on sustainable energy resources, and evolving engineering trends have together made Electrical Engineering one of the most popular fields for students to take up after Class 12.

There are more than 5,500 Electrical Engineering colleges in India, including both private-owned, the ones falling under the jurisdiction of the government, and the public-private colleges. All of these institutions are known for their placement records where Electrical Engineering students are offered decent packages during the recruitment fairs when top recruiters visit the colleges for hiring purposes.
For example, if you're an IIT BTech EE graduate, you can get an average salary package between INR 20 LPA and INR 30 LPA. On the other hand, if you're an NIT student, you can expect around INR 10 LPA to INR 15 LPA after your BTech degree in Electrical Engineering. Other private EE colleges also offer good earning opportunities for Electrical Engineering graduates.
